Gross monthly income works out to about $3,556,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,067/mo in rent. Fayetteville's median rent of $1,720 exceeds that threshold by $653/mo, putting a welder salary into the rent-burdened range here. A welder works roughly 83.8 hours a month to cover that rent.

Welder pay tracks the US median household income closely. Pipeline and underwater welders earn materially more. At the national-average welder salary, the 30% rule supports about $1,285 a month in rent.
